Guillermo Heredia’s two RBI’s key SSG’s win. (+Asian League Report)

Guillermo Heredia continues to be a catalyst for the SSG Landers’ offense. In today’s game the Cuban outfielder set the tone for the Korean squad with a first inning two run single that was the difference in team’s 3-2 victory over the Samsung Lions. Heredia who leads the KBO with a .329 average is also fifth in the league with 31 RBIs.

In the NPB Ariel Martínez collected a hit in three at-bats in Nippon-Ham’s 2-1 win over the Yakult Swallows. The Cuban catcher broke a recent slump and saw his average jump to .239 on the campaign. Martínez on the season is slugging a solid .430 and has also blasted six homeruns on the campaign.

In the CPBL Elían Leyva had his worst outing of the season against the Chinatrust Brothers Elephants. The right-hander was hit hard in four innings giving five earned runs via eight hits to watch his ERA rise to 3.28 on the campaign. Rakuten fell to Brothers 10-9.
